About the Company
IDP Education is a world leader in international student placement services. Our global network of 89 offices helps students from 30 countries to study in Australia, Canada, New Zealand, the USA and the UK.
IDP Education Ltd is an ASX listed company that is 50% owned by 38 Australian universities. For more than 45 years, IDP Education has played a major role in international education.
IDP Education is also a proud co-owner of IELTS (International English Language Testing System). IELTS is jointly owned by British Council, IDP: IELTS Australia and Cambridge English Language Assessment. Since its launch in 1989, IELTS has become the world’s most popular high-stakes English language proficiency test.
